Chaenyung Cha is a scholar working on Biomedical Engineering, Molecular Medicine and Biomaterials. According to data from OpenAlex, Chaenyung Cha has authored 82 papers receiving a total of 3.8k indexed citations (citations by other indexed papers that have themselves been cited), including 61 papers in Biomedical Engineering, 31 papers in Molecular Medicine and 26 papers in Biomaterials. Recurrent topics in Chaenyung Cha’s work include 3D Printing in Biomedical Research (42 papers), Hydrogels: synthesis, properties, applications (31 papers) and Cellular Mechanics and Interactions (16 papers). Chaenyung Cha is often cited by papers focused on 3D Printing in Biomedical Research (42 papers), Hydrogels: synthesis, properties, applications (31 papers) and Cellular Mechanics and Interactions (16 papers). Chaenyung Cha collaborates with scholars based in South Korea, United States and Singapore. Chaenyung Cha's co-authors include Ali Khademhosseini, Mehmet R. Dokmeci, Nasim Annabi, Su Ryon Shin, Hyunjoon Kong, Nicholas A. Peppas, Gulden Camci‐Unal, Jorge Alfredo Uquillas, Ali Tamayol and Luiz E. Bertassoni and has published in prestigious journals such as Angewandte Chemie International Edition, Advanced Materials and Nature Materials.
